Community Service & Activities
Sigma Gamma Rho and the Rhoer club foster Sisterhood, Service and Scholarship. Throughout the year, the Rhoers are involved in various community service projects, programs, fundraisers and bonding activities. Here are some examples :
Bonding Activities
Rhoer Round Up - Rhoers get together for fun activities and invite young ladies who are interested to learn more about the Rhoer club.
Paint Party w/ the Rhoers - Rhoers and other ladies were creative with making a painting that was designed by our Soror Ashley Jones.
The rhoers have also participated in the strolling and stepping, escape room, sleepovers, bowling, skating, movie night, virtual monthly sisterhood activities on a regional level. This is a great opportunity for rhoers to interact with other rhoers in the region.
National Programs
Youth Symposium - a day of education provided by alumnae chapters to youth and community members to address the concerns that negative impact our youth today.
Women's Wellness Activities-Breast Cancer Awareness, Human Trafficking with Pittsburgh Action Against Rape, HIV Awareness, Self Defense Class with Lioness Martial Arts, and many other programming.
Community Service
Ward Home - collecting items for young ladies living independently in the Ward Home, which is a community based program that serves at risk youth, ages 16 to 21, who have grown up in the foster care system.
Ronald McDonald House- Prepare breakfast, lunch or dinner for individuals receiving services from the Ronald McDonald House
Trunk or Treat with Light of Life Mission- made candy bags and handed them out to kids to promote a safe Halloween Night!
FUNdraising
Bake Sale- sold baked goods at a local school. Rhoers worked together to make brownies, cupcakes and cake pops. The night ended with a Sleepover!!
Crafton Celebrates - Rhoers set up a Ring toss booth at the Crafton festival and raised $$$ for their programming.
Candle Fundraiser- this fundraiser helped the rhoer raise money to buy hair kits with natural hair care products.The kits were given to girls and teenagers in the the foster care system.
